#define FLT_DIG_PRINTF FLT_DIG + 6
#define DBL_DIG_PRINTF DBL_DIG + 6
#ifndef DOUBLE_EQ
#define DOUBLE_EQ(obt, exp, epsilon) \
((((obt) - (exp)) <= (epsilon)) && (((obt) - (exp)) >= -(epsilon)))
#endif
#ifndef FLOAT_EQ
#define FLOAT_EQ(obt, exp, epsilon) \
((((obt) - (exp)) <= (epsilon)) && (((obt) - (exp)) >= -(epsilon)))
#endif
#define CHECK(exp) { if ( !exp ) { \
fprintf(stderr, "Check failed on line %d\n", __LINE__); \
exit(EXIT_FAILURE); } }
/* FIXME: Macro uses C99 integral type, might be not portable */
#define CHECK_EQUALS(obt, exp) { if ( (long long)obt != (long long)exp ) { \
fprintf(stderr, "Check failed on line %d\n", __LINE__); \
fprintf(stderr, "\tactual = %lld, expected = %lld\n", (long long)obt, (long long)exp ); \
exit(EXIT_FAILURE); } }
#define CHECK_EQUALS_FLOAT_EX(obt, exp, eps) { if ( !FLOAT_EQ(obt, exp, eps) ) { \
fprintf(stderr, "Check failed on line %d\n", __LINE__); \
fprintf(stderr, "\tactual = %.*g, expected = %.*g\n", FLT_DIG_PRINTF, obt, FLT_DIG_PRINTF, exp ); \
exit(EXIT_FAILURE); } }
#define CHECK_EQUALS_FLOAT(obt, exp) { if ( !FLOAT_EQ(obt, exp, FLT_EPSILON) ) { \
fprintf(stderr, "Check failed on line %d\n", __LINE__); \
fprintf(stderr, "\tactual = %.*g, expected = %.*g\n", FLT_DIG_PRINTF, obt, FLT_DIG_PRINTF, exp ); \
exit(EXIT_FAILURE); } }
#define CHECK_EQUALS_DOUBLE_EX(obt, exp, eps) { if ( !DOUBLE_EQ(obt, exp, eps) ) { \
fprintf(stderr, "Check failed on line %d\n", __LINE__); \
fprintf(stderr, "\tactual = %.*g, expected = %.*g\n", DBL_DIG_PRINTF, obt, DBL_DIG_PRINTF, exp ); \
exit(EXIT_FAILURE); } }
#define CHECK_EQUALS_DOUBLE(obt, exp) { if ( !DOUBLE_EQ(obt, exp, DBL_EPSILON) ) { \
fprintf(stderr, "Check failed on line %d\n", __LINE__); \
fprintf(stderr, "\tactual = %.*g, expected = %.*g\n", DBL_DIG_PRINTF, obt, DBL_DIG_PRINTF, exp ); \
exit(EXIT_FAILURE); } }
